Transaction 24c59974026d2f258b258dde205b53f8496540cfffda57e7f8aee0fa2eb4c4fc
1 Input
1 Output
-
24c59974026d2f258b258dde205b53f8496540cfffda57e7f8aee0fa2eb4c4fc:0
- value
- 522566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c031442216a8c6dcb9f255ed83e5a95f882356f OP_EQUAL
- address
- 34F8XrfAzGJWkusuZk6Jnx7XdEddGTVtFL